Holcomb-In-One Las Vegas Pro-Am – Final Results

The team of Billy Bomar of Prairie Falls GC and amateurs Larry Buss, Dave Faulk, Mike Bergt and Greg Sanders won the overall team competition for the week to be crowned 2017 Holcomb-In-One Las Vegas Pro-Am Champions. Congratulations gentleman!

Day 1 – the team of PGA Professional Derek Siesser from The Creek at Qualchan with amateurs Erik Olson, Mike Gonzalez, Buzz Adams and Joe Holcombe won the low team honors at The Las Vegas CC in the team Stableford competition.

Low professional honors went to Derek as well. Sean Fredrickson of Tualatin CC and Billy Bomar of Prairie Falls GC finished in second two points back.

Erik Olson of Riverbend GC won low amateur gross honors while Norm Weber of Hayden Lake CC won the low  amateur net honors.

Day 2 – the team with PGA Professional Billy Bomar of Prairie Falls GC and amateurs Larry Buss, Dave Faulk, Mike Bergt and Greg Sanders won the low team honors at Chimera GC for the Holcomb-In-One Las Vegas Pro-Am.

Low PGA Professional honors went to Gordon Corder of Manito G&CC. Ryan Young of Chambers Bay was one point behind.

Greg Sanders from Alaska Golf Association was the low amateur (gross) honors. Joe Gibson from Shadow Hills CC, Derek Mills from McCormick Woods GC, Ben Focke from Hayden Lake CC, Mike Wrightson from Imperial Headwear all tied for first for the low amateur (net) honors.

Day 3 – The team of Billy Bomar of Prairie Falls GC and amateurs Larry Buss, Dave Faulk, Mike Bergt and Greg Sanders won the low team honors on Wednesday once again for the Holcomb-In-One Las Vegas Pro-Am at Anthem CC.  They also won the overall team competition for the week to be crowned 2017 Holcomb-In-One Las Vegas Pro-Am Champions.  Congratulations gentleman!

Low professional honors went to Billy Bomar (he also won the overall Professional Competition for the week).

Low amateur (gross) honors went to John Corbin of Meadow Springs CC, Greg Sanders of Alaska Golf Association, and Jeff Sweat of Manito G&CC.

Low amateur (net) honors went to Rod Martin of Shadow Hills CC.

Overall amateur (gross) honors went to Greg Sanders while overall amateur (net) honors went to Branden Reynolds of Hayden Lake CC.

Representative Grant Holcomb is the title sponsor of this championship (for the 14th year) with companies Antigua, Slazenger, Sun Mountain Sports, PlayKleen, Certifresh Cigars, Range Servant, and Imperial Headwear.
